ABC Gardening Australia host Sophie Thomson and the team of dedicated planters from Toowoomba Region’s Parks team put their highly-skilled green thumbs to the test, on a mission this week to plant 68,000 annuals and 10,500 bulbs just for Laurel Bank Park alone.

With planting underway of nearly 160,000 annuals and 20,00 bulbs, this year’s Toowoomba Carnival of Flowers is set to be the one of the biggest yet.
